Description

This is a letter from Tenant to Landlord in which Tenant claims that Landlord's failure to abide by the continuing requirements of the Lease Agreement by denying Tenant certain services is retaliation for some action initiated by Tenant. This letter provides notice to Landlord that such retaliatory action is in breach of the lease agreement and may constitute a further violation of the law. [Your Name] [Your Address] [City, State, ZIP Code] [Email Address] [Phone Number] [Date] [Landlord's Name] [Landlord's Address] [City, State, ZIP Code] Subject: Notice to Cease Retaliatory Decrease in Services Dear [Landlord's Name], I hope this letter finds you in good health and high spirits. I am writing to you as a tenant of [property address] in Detroit, Michigan, to bring to your attention a matter that requires immediate resolution. I am deeply concerned about the recent decrease in services, which I believe is in retaliation for exercising my rights as a tenant. As you are aware, under Michigan law, tenants have certain rights and responsibilities, including the right to complain about unsafe or unsanitary conditions in the rental unit. It has come to my attention that, since I raised concerns about repairs that needed to be addressed in my unit on [date], there has been a discernible decline in the quality of services provided. I would like to assert that this decrease in services appears to be retaliatory in nature, as it commenced shortly after I reported the necessary repairs. Such retaliatory actions are prohibited under Michigan's landlord-tenant laws, specifically, Section 554.139 of the Michigan Compiled Laws. I have identified the following changes that have transpired: 1. Maintenance and Repairs: Despite my repeated requests for the necessary repairs, there has been a considerable delay in addressing these issues, which compromises my comfort and safety within the premises. 2. Pest Control: I have noticed an escalation in pest infestation, particularly [specify pests], in my unit, making it difficult for me to reside comfortably. 3. Common Area Maintenance: The general upkeep and cleanliness of the common areas have significantly deteriorated, putting the health and safety of all tenants at risk. 4. Landscaping and Grounds keeping: The once well-maintained landscaping and grounds have now become unkempt, giving the property an unappealing appearance. This neglect reflects poorly on the overall livability of the complex. As a dedicated and responsible tenant, I have consistently fulfilled my obligations to pay rent on time and maintain the premises in good condition. It is disheartening to witness a retaliatory response that directly impacts my quality of life and enjoyment of the property. I kindly request that you take immediate action to cease the retaliatory decrease in services and restore the standard of services that were provided prior to my reporting of necessary repairs. Failure to do so will leave me with no choice but to exercise my rights and pursue further legal actions available to me under the Michigan landlord-tenant laws. I trust that, as a reasonable and fair landlord, you understand the importance of addressing these concerns promptly. Please provide me with a written response within [reasonable time frame, e.g., 14 days] outlining your plan of action to rectify this situation promptly. Thank you for your attention to this matter. I believe that open communication and cooperation can lead to a resolution that benefits both parties involved. I look forward to a prompt and amicable resolution. Sincerely, [Your Name]
